This is the preamble of the 20 April 1977 Luxembourg law on games of chance, sports betting, and related matters; it introduces the law and its formal adoption. The exploitation of games of chance is prohibited. Advertising contests and free lotteries/tombolas used only for commercial promotion are not treated as games of chance under this law. It bans installing certain money, token, and chance-based machines in public roads and public places, including drinking establishments, with a narrow exception for machines that do not give any material gain beyond continuing to play. Sports betting on sporting events needs prior authorization from the Minister of Justice.
